A dual diagnosis is a diagnosis of a co-occurring addiction and mental health disorder. This could be an occurrence of both a substance abuse addiction along with an anxiety disorder, or a gambling addiction coupled with depression. It may be many things all co-occurring simultaneously, with particular disorders making other problems worse or even stimulating them. For instance, someone's alcohol abuse might be stimulated by their desire to find relief from their depression or anxiety. Someone might be struggling with depression because of their drug or alcohol use. It often requires professionals to discover the causes of each of the issues the person is battling and come up with a treatment strategy that will successfully resolve both simultaneously so that the person can live a drug-free and psychologically healthy life.
